For the third straight game to open conference play, Temple shot less than 40 percent from the field in the first half. That combined with Southern Methodist’s rebounding and scoring runs put Temple in a deficit as big as 21 points.
The Owls showed signs of life with a 13-3 run in the second half that included a steal, layup and an alley-oop by freshman guard Quinton Rose to cut it to a 10-point game. Rose got another one of his five steals and converted a layup on the other end to make it a nine-point game with one minute, 53 seconds left.
